February 18th join us for this special dual presentation on supporting our emerging readers

and mathematicians. Our very own Katie Michols, a Reading Specialist at Copeland will provide some

tips and strategies for supporting emerging readers. Afterwards, Courtney Linn a former math solutions

intervention manager with Scholastic will share some math games she’s created, adapted or used at home with her children to encourage the love of math and development of number sense and basic mathematical skills and concepts. We look forward

to this fun and educational morning together!

Kristin Watson, [email protected] or Jenn Surber, [email protected] Mass for the Innocents Each year the Bereavement Ministry sponsors a Mass to remember and honor children of all ages who have died. Their passing may have been recent or long ago. It could have been due to illness, accident, premature birth or abortion; whatever the reason. While we advertise this Mass in the Carpenter and on the parish website, we feel we may not be reaching everyone who would find comfort in participating in this beautiful commemorative celebration. This year the mass will be held on April 5. We are asking for your help. We would like to send personal invitations to parents, grandparents, siblings, relatives and friends who have experienced the loss of a child. This Mass is open to all.
